I guess I should answer my own question in case someone else is going stand alone and wants to retain the factory module.
I purchashed an oscilliscope and took some readings. The module recieves a 4.0V - 4.2V signal from the computer. The dwell @ Idle is 2.4ms 1000RPM is 2.4ms 2000RPM is 2.2ms 3000RPM is 2.0ms 4000RPM is 2.0ms 5000RPM is 2.0ms Now I have to find out the crank and cam sensors.
